Which of the following anions has a valency of -3?

  1. A. Nitride
  2. B. Nitrate
  3. C. Sulphide
  4. D. Sulphate

Correct Answer: A. Nitride

Explanation

The nitride ion (N^{3-}) has a valency of -3. Nitrate is -1, sulphide is -2, and sulphate is -2.
